大直径埋地钢管管顶土压力及其设计模型研究

Soil pressures at top of large-diameter buried steel pipes and their design model

  • 摘要: 以往埋地钢管的管顶土压力研究结果多基于小直径管道,对大直径管道并不完全适用。建立了埋地钢管有限元计算模型,分析了不同管径、径厚比和埋深下的管顶土压力,并与传统设计模型进行比较,探讨了相关参数对土压力的影响。提出了一种新型的土压力设计模型——盆式模型,采用“直线+抛物线”形式描述土压力分布,根据管径和埋深情况采用“Marston+胸腔”荷载计算土压力数值,并深入研究了盆式模型对大直径埋地钢管的适用性。结果表明:对于大直径埋地钢管,管顶土压力分布的基本形式为“倒盆形”,径厚比及埋深均会显著影响土压力,但径厚比大于200后,土压力变化很小;管径小时,土压力大体呈抛物线分布。增加回填土变形模量和泊松比、沟槽接触面粗糙程度,减小沟槽宽度,均可降低土压力,但影响有限。高埋深时,棱柱荷载过大;低埋深时,Marston荷载偏小,这两种模型的计算精度及适应性较差;盆式模型与有限元分析的计算结果吻合度较好,计算精度高,适应性强,可为大直径埋地钢管的结构设计及规范制定提供借鉴和参考。

     

    Abstract: The previous research results of soil pressures at the top of buried steel pipes are mostly based on the small-diameter pipes, which are not fully suitable for large-diameter pipes. Here a numerical investigation is conducted on the soil pressures from the aspects of pipe diameter, diameter-thickness ratio and cover depth, and it is furtherly compared with the traditional design models. The influence parameters on the soil pressure are discussed. A new design model for soil pressures, basin model, is proposed. Wherein, the distribution of the soil pressures is described as "straight line + parabola", and the load calculation adopts the "Marston + pleura" according to the pipe diameter and cover depth. Furthermore, the applicability of the basin model is studied. The results show that the basic form of the soil pressures is the "inverted basin" distribution for large-diameter pipes, while the soil pressures are a parabolic distribution for small-diameter pipes. The diameter-thickness ratio and cover depth have significant influences on the soil pressures, but the soil pressures change very little after the diameter-thickness ratio is greater than 200. The increase of the elastic modulus and Poisson's ratio of backfill and roughness of trench interface, and the decrease of trench width can slightly reduce the soil pressures. The prism and Marston load are too large at high cover depth and small at low cover depth, respectively, which have poor accuracy and adaptability. The basin model is in good agreement with the finite element results, with high calculation accuracy and strong adaptability. It can provide a reference for the structural design of large-diameter buried steel pipes.
